SEC SAAC, Football Leadership Council Meet

Vanderbilt's Cameron Robinson, Caleb Van Geffen and Kaley Buchanan to meet with SEC's groups

BIRMINGHAM, Ala. — The Southeastern Conference Student-Athlete Advisory Committee (SAAC) and the SEC Football Leadership Council will have an opportunity to engage with campus leaders and conference office staff during their virtual meetings scheduled for Monday.

Agenda items for both groups include a conversation with SEC Commissioner Greg Sankey and updates on NCAA governance and the student-athlete panel of the SEC Council on Racial Equity and Social Justice. The Football Leadership Council will also have an opportunity to engage with Wilbur Hackett, a pioneer of integration in SEC football.

Members of the SEC Student-Athlete Advisory Committee represent each of the SEC’s 14 universities and 14 of the SEC’s sponsored sports. The Football Leadership Council, which consists of one football student-athlete from each SEC university, serves as a conduit of communication to the conference office on issues related to student-athlete experience and student-athlete wellness.
